Output 50b08bdbae62c98dc3daf7071b773b0f1342f350c2576877ebce6ac3c3d98b53:1

value
1589062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 205aca45adb148a2ae8f532c8b7b94c9a0fad605 OP_EQUAL
address
34e6Jtd5YSkR8RHLupFCnuQtu5V5QMJvfT
transaction
50b08bdbae62c98dc3daf7071b773b0f1342f350c2576877ebce6ac3c3d98b53
confirmations
368887
spent
true